Output cd62ff2cf8d54fc86e7512fabe4f2f4c61d79cfe26e4b80f5aa910aa8d0b040f:0

value
1918828
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 afb73d3256ce235a27ccebf1add03ded1c62ad68 OP_EQUALVERIFY OP_CHECKSIG
address
1H26mF5Mh5osrscPWyDUtkFURZpJPsqiWy
transaction
cd62ff2cf8d54fc86e7512fabe4f2f4c61d79cfe26e4b80f5aa910aa8d0b040f
confirmations
525622
spent
true